Connecting a Power Source

Keep the battery pack in the notebook while it is directly connected to AC 
power. The battery pack continues to charge while you are using the notebook.
If your battery level falls to less than 10%, you should either attach the AC 
adapter to recharge the battery or shut down your notebook and insert a fully-
charged battery.
You can extend battery life by changing the power management modes in the 
Power Panel utility. See “Power Saving Modes” 
The battery pack supplied with your notebook is a lithium ion battery and can 
be recharged at any time. Charging a partially discharged battery does not 
affect battery life.
The battery indicator light is on while you use the battery pack as a power 
source. When battery life is nearly depleted, the battery indicator starts 
flashing.
Your notebook may not enter Hibernate mode when the battery life is low, when 
certain software applications are running, or when certain peripheral devices 
are connected. To avoid loss of data when using battery power, you should save 
your data frequently and manually activate a power management modes.
